What Stewardship Means at GeoComms

GeoComms approaches environmental and social responsibility through stewardship—the careful analysis, interpretation, and communication of risks affecting land, watersheds, infrastructure, and communities.

Rather than producing generalized sustainability statements, our work focuses on evidence-based diagnostics, cause-analysis, and preventive insight where environmental stress, land misuse, and infrastructure failure intersect.

Our Stewardship Approach

  • Environmental Diagnosis Before Intervention

    Understanding hydrological, geomorphological, land-use, and infrastructure interactions before recommending solutions.

  • Prevention Through Systems Clarity

    Analyzing how upstream land practices, watershed behavior, and built systems interact under climate stress.

  • Education as Risk Reduction

    Clear explanation of failure mechanisms to prevent repeat damage.
